Publisher's Synopsis

Libby's chocolates sell like hot cakes... until people begin to die.

When a group of cyclists, all customers at the bakery in small town Exham-on-Sea, are poisoned, suspicion falls on the shop itself, and Libby's food.

In partnership with attractive, blue-eyed Max Ramshore and his huge sheepdog, Bear, Libby Forest sets out to uncover the poisoner and save the bakery.

But who can she trust when even her deceased husband wasn't all he seemed?
